Character pages are a large chunk of the wiki, but they're often filled with problems that don't get resolved. These problems include:
- Zero Context Examples
- Indentation problems, including bulleting tropes under supertropes or tropeslashing
- Spoiler tag misuse
- A lack of alphabetization
- Empty character folders
- Plagiarized character descriptions
- Misused tropes, or tropes that don't belong on character pages
- Broken or incorrect formatting
- Subjective / Trivia trope mentions
Per How to Create a Character Page, character pages should only include tropes that describe the characters. These tropes should fall under Characterization Tropes or one of its related indexes, Unless they're recurring character traits (distinctive things that the character does repeatedly). If you're unsure what counts as a character trope, you can ask about that at Are These Character Tropes.
All characters must have at least one contextualized trope for their section or folder to be visible. If you find a character that has no contextualized tropes present, comment out the entire section and add this tag:

I'm concerned about the current status of the Sonic the Hedgehog - Antagonists page.
The page splits up characters using "Eras" as Sonic Generations does, with there being three eras: "Classic", "Dreamcast", and "Modern". While this was an effective way to separate periods of Sonic history at the time Generations came out, it's becoming more and more obsolete; since the idea of splitting the eras into more than just "Classic" and "Modern" hasn't been explored much more by the series, the "Modern Era" section of the character page now covers fifteen years of Sonic games. By contrast, the "Classic Era" (assuming it ends with Sonic R) covers six years of games (1991-1997), while the "Dreamcast Era" (assuming it ends with Sonic Riders, which was released the same year as the explicitly-stated "Modern" game Sonic the Hedgehog (2006), but predates it by about 9 months) covers eight years (1998-2006).
Furthermore, the console and Nintendo 3DS versions of Generations are inconsistent on what counts as the "Dreamcast Era". The 3DS version counts "Dreamcast" as only the Sega Dreamcast itself (indicated by the Sonic Adventure games being the only two games in the era, and a boss from Sonic Heroes serving as the boss of the game's "Modern" section), the console versions count The Sixth Generation Of Console Video Games as a whole as being within the "Dreamcast Era" (shown by Heroes being one of the three games represented in its "Dreamcast" section). The character page, meanwhile, contradicts itself by counting Shadow the Hedgehog as part of the "Dreamcast Era", but counting Sonic Rush and Sonic Riders as part of the "Modern Era".
Overall, I don't think the "Era" system works as a means of separating the characters on the antagonists page, especially when it's the only page to do so.
